Accessible parts will become hot when in use, to avoid burns and scalds children
should be kept away
Do not leave the packaging unsupervised for, the safety of Children.
Replaced appliances must be taken to a special garbage
collection centre
Always use oven gloves to remove and replace food in
the oven. Ensure that you support the grill pan when
removing from the oven.
Do not allow persons especially children sit down or play
with the oven door. Do not use the drop down door as
a stool to reach above cabinets.
Warning:
Never use the food-warmer drawer set at the bottom of the range to store
flammable substances or matters that cannot withstand heat such as:
wood, paper, spray cans, rags, etc.
General Warnings
This electric appliance complies with the following directives:
- 2004/108/EEC (electromagnetic compatibility)
- 89/109/EEC (foodstuffs)
- 2006/95/EEC (low voltage)
Before using the oven for the first time, we suggest to:
remove the special film covering the oven door glass
(when provided)
heat the empty oven at max. temperature for 45 minutes
(to remove unpleasant smell and smoke caused by
working residues and by the thermal insulation)
carefully clean inside the oven with soapy water and rinse it .
For any repairs always contact an authorised Service Centre and ask for
original spare parts. Repairs by untrained people will void your warranty on this
product.
